An excellent storybook for siblings of adopted children

Jin Woo


The story is a simple one. David is an only child. Mom and I are in the process of adopting a sibling for him, a little baby brother from Korea. The only thing is David isn't as thrilled as his parents are about Jin Woo's arrival. He's even less thrilled when the baby arrives. But a special letter "written" by the baby lets David know that being a big brother is a job filled with love - from all sides. What I especially like is the examination of David's feelings as he moves from only child to big brother. The artist - a Korean adoptee himself - shows unique skill and sensitivity in his illustrations of the children and family. Warm and wonderfully written and luminously illustrated in realistic watercolors, this is an excellent book for adoptive families with children already living in the home. I recommend it highly!
